Information Security Policy

Overview

We are committed to protecting the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of our customers' information. While we are a small organization, we implement practical security measures to safeguard data and reduce security risks.

Access Control

Access to company systems and customer data is granted only to authorized personnel.

User accounts are assigned based on business needs.

Access is removed when an employee or contractor no longer requires it.

Strong passwords and multi-factor authentication (MFA) are used where available.

Data Protection

Data is encrypted in transit using HTTPS/TLS.

Sensitive data is stored using industry-standard security measures provided by our technology vendors and cloud service providers.

Access to customer data is limited to personnel who require it to perform their job duties.

Infrastructure Security

Our systems are hosted by reputable cloud service providers that maintain their own physical and network security controls in Canada or Germnay based on client’s operation site.

Firewalls, endpoint protection, and security monitoring tools are used where appropriate.

Software and systems are regularly updated to address known security vulnerabilities.

Security Monitoring and Incident Response

We monitor our systems for unusual activity and security issues.

Security incidents are investigated promptly.

If a security event impacts customer data, affected customers will be notified in accordance with applicable legal and contractual requirements.

Employee Awareness

Employees and contractors are expected to follow security best practices.

Security and privacy responsibilities are communicated during onboarding and reinforced as needed.

Privacy and Data Handling

Customer information is used only for legitimate business purposes.

We collect and retain only the information necessary to provide our services.

Customer data is handled confidentially and protected against unauthorized access.

Upon request and subject to contractual and legal requirements, customer data may be returned or deleted.

Third-Party Providers

We rely on trusted third-party service providers for certain business operations and infrastructure services.

We make reasonable efforts to select providers with appropriate security and privacy practices.

Business Continuity

Critical business data is backed up using the capabilities provided by our service providers.

We maintain processes to support recovery from unexpected outages or disruptions.

Policy Review

This policy is reviewed periodically and updated as our business, technology, and security requirements evolve.
